Why Is My Hoover Tumble Dryer Smells Burning?
A burning smell from a tumble dryer is a serious warning sign and should not be ignored. Stop the machine immediately and investigate the cause before using it again.
Common Causes
Lint buildup on the heating element
The most common cause. Lint that has accumulated inside the machine cabinet can be ignited or scorched by the heating element, producing a burning smell. This is a fire risk.
Blocked lint filter
Severe lint filter blockage can cause the heating element to overheat and scorch, producing a burning smell.
Burning belt or drum component
A worn or slipping drive belt, drum glide or roller can produce a burning rubber smell.
Electrical fault
A burning electrical smell (like burning plastic) can indicate a wiring fault or failing motor that requires immediate professional attention.
New machine smell
A mild burning smell on a brand new dryer is normal for the first few cycles as manufacturing residues burn off.
Checks To Try Before Calling An Engineer
Stop the machine immediately
If you smell burning, stop the machine and unplug it. Do not use it again until the cause has been identified.
Clean the lint filter and inside the cabinet
Clean the lint filter thoroughly and check inside the machine cabinet for lint accumulation around the heating element.
Check the drum for foreign objects
A plastic item left in a pocket and scorched by the heating element can produce a burning smell.
Check if the smell is rubber or electrical
A rubber smell suggests a worn belt or roller. An electrical burning smell suggests a wiring or motor fault — do not use the machine until it has been inspected.

When To Contact A Professional
Any burning smell that is not caused by a new machine or a foreign object should be investigated by a qualified engineer before the machine is used again. Burning lint is a fire risk.
